Price: $180
Weight: 2.4 lb.
A relative newcomer to the retail market, Uffy has supplied industrial users for some time and claims that its nailers are made for industrial use. I found this tool to be a no-frills, capable performer. Externally, its look and features are very similar to those of the Grip-Rite. It performed well at odd angles, while shooting quietly and with little recoil. Features: belt hook, rear exhaust, and rear wrap-around safety.
